Understanding the Core Gameplay: How it Works
At its heart, this game is remarkably simple to understand. A digital airplane takes off, and as it gains altitude, a multiplying coefficient begins to increase. The core objective is to cash out—to claim your winnings—before the plane crashes. The longer you wait, the higher the multiplier, and the larger your potential payout. However, with each passing second, the risk of a crash intensifies. This inherent tension is what makes the gameplay so compelling.

Understanding Crash Mechanics and Algorithms
The core of any ‘crash’ game lies in its Random Number Generator (RNG). These are complex algorithms designed to ensure fairness and unpredictability. While entirely random, they still operate within set parameters determining the crash point. Players frequently attempt to identify patterns, but true randomness makes consistently predicting crashes incredibly difficult. Understanding this is crucial to managing expectations.
Most platforms employ provably fair systems ensuring transparency. This system uses cryptographic techniques that allow players independently verify the randomness of each game and its results, offering reassurance against manipulation. Players can check past game results and verify against published seeds and nonces.
Here is a quick overview of key terms to understand:
| RNG | Random Number Generator – determines the crash multiplier. |
| Provably Fair | System allowing verified game fairness. |
| Seed | A value used to initiate an RNG algorithm. |
